How this content is produced

Every guide on this site is written against primary sources: the Moneylenders Act and the Moneylenders Rules, Ministry of Law guidance, and JD Credit’s own lending practice. Before a guide is published it is reviewed by JD Credit’s lending team to confirm that what it describes matches how borrowing actually works in a licensed office.

Articles are dated and reviewed when the rules change. We do not publish guaranteed-approval claims, and we do not quote figures we cannot source. If you spot something on this site that is wrong or out of date, write to enquiry@jdcredit.com.sg and we will correct it.
